Never ever use chlorine bleach to clean up your homes roof. When chlorine bleach is a thing which is very effective at washing several places of your home, it should never be employed to nice and clean your homes roof. The reason being the chemicals found in bleach are corrosive, and they may cause a lot of harm to the roof structure components.

When picking among roofers, speak to your community Better Enterprise Bureau for guidance. They will let you know if any one of the companies you are looking for have grievances registered in opposition to them, a serious warning sign. You can also discover how very long they are providing your group like a firm.

Before buying a fresh property, you need to have your roof looked over by way of a specialist. An ordinary residence assessment may well miss out on issues with the roofing, and can result in major trouble for you down the line. As an extra, if you decide to offer your home, you'll have the ability to demonstrate the results of your evaluation to potential consumers.

If you see roof structure injury in the direction of the middle of the roof, then it is likely you do not have water damage. Alternatively, it is likely you have dried up rot, which occurs anytime the plywood is deteriorating. You can prevent this issue by putting in a ridge vent. Even so, so that you can put in this kind of vent, you have to have a properly working soffit vent. Drill slots with the soffit vent so awesome air arises from the bottom and warm air is pressed out of the best.

Coated aluminum roofing can be a extremely sensible method to use and good for the environment. Steel is totally recyclable, and it and reduce your power expenses. A covered metal roof structure can even be put more than concrete ceramic tiles, meaning your outdated roof top won't be blocking up a dump.

When choosing materials for your new roof, take into account the colours. Living inside a hotter environment, select gentle colors. Beige, bright white and light grey represent the sunshine, maintaining your home much cooler. For cold environments, deeper colors are the best choice. Select dark, deep light brown or charcoal grey shingles and floor tiles. This raises your home's electricity productivity.

Think twice before using mortar in order to avoid weathering at junctions and verges. Whilst mortar is probably the most affordable possibilities, it is also one of the the very least durable. In addition, it incurs extra costs in the requirement for normal upkeep. Dry-resolve roof covering methods will cost more up front, they also generally have lengthier lifespans and higher sturdiness.
